CAGEfightR
CAGEfightR identifies transcription start sites and predicts enhancers from Cap Analysis of Gene Expression (CAGE) data for downstream quantification, annotation, TSS shape analysis, and visualization.
Key Features:
- Fast, memory-efficient TSS identification: Tag clustering algorithms identify transcription start sites (TSSs) from CAGE tags.
- Enhancer prediction via bidirectional clustering: Bidirectional clustering of CAGE tags detects putative enhancers based on divergent transcription.
- Annotation with transcript and gene models: Annotates TSSs and predicted enhancers using existing transcript and gene models.
- Quantification of CAGE expression: Produces expression matrices quantifying CAGE signal for comparative analyses.
- TSS shape statistics: Calculates TSS shape metrics to characterize transcription initiation profiles.
- Visualization functions: Provides plotting and visualization of tag clusters, TSSs, and enhancers.
- R/Bioconductor integration: Implements data structures and workflows compatible with R and Bioconductor.
Scientific Applications:
- Gene regulation: Mapping TSSs and enhancers to investigate transcriptional regulation across conditions.
- Epigenetics: Linking CAGE-defined regulatory elements to chromatin and epigenetic studies of gene activity.
- Comparative genomics: Comparing CAGE expression profiles across species or conditions to identify conserved regulatory elements.
Methodology:
Performs unidirectional (tag) and bidirectional clustering algorithms on CAGE tags to identify TSSs and enhancers, computes TSS shape statistics, and integrates results with R/Bioconductor data structures.
